2009-11-09T15:21:58-06:00 2009-11-09T15:21:58-06:00 http://www.vintaxe.com/phpBB3/viewtopic.php?t=2031&p=7522#p7522 <![CDATA[Guitar ID please... poss Klira ??]]> Apparently Klira manufactured guitars under other brand badges as well as their own, namely Triumphator and Holiday. They also distributed some models via a German electronics catalogue in the 60's called Quelle. These catalogue models were unbranded and produced as white label products, i guess so the catalogue could claim them as their own?

Could well be the reason for the lack of branding on this model and may well have been manufactured specifically for that catalogue??

There's a "Lady" in this thread with identical features but a different headstock, apparently branded Triumphator:
http://www.euroguitars.co.uk/viewtopic.php?f=8&t=26

So it is clearly a Klira or a close relation of.

His first interesting observation is that only the cheapest models were marketed domestically in Germany; almost all higher-end models were exported.

He also states "the electrical equipment changed several times and so overall there were many different versions" (of the same model).

Although Schnepel admits dating the instruments is difficult, he has the 2 pickup version of the Peggy introduced in 1965 and the 3 pickup version appearing in 1966. I would surmise yours is one of the early models given the control cavity cover.

In my 1965 Klira catalog, the Lady and the Sir have identical control panels. If you check the Sir pictured on this website you'll see that the control layout is completely different than the Lady which is pictured a bit below it.

So, Klira was clearly making pretty radical modifications in their instruments and keeping the same name on them. In this context, I bet your guitar is just one of their variations on a Peggy.

BTW, the control panel on the Lady they have pictured on the site is different from the Lady pictured in my literature. The panel on the Lady in my catalog matches the panel on your Peggy. So your guitar was likely built around 1965.

I agree that the body, neck an pickups look like the 1965 Peggy.

The bridge and the metal control plate are features you see on the Klira Lady and Sir. I don't see that trem tailpiece on any of the Klira's I have pictured in my literature.

I'm sure it is a Klira, I'm just not sure what model it might be. It might be something that was built when they were phasing out the Lady, Sir and Peggy, perhaps assembled from the leftovers. It's a mystery to me, maybe someone more familiar with Klira's will stop by and help out.
